#4c80b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c80b6 is composed of 29.8% red, 50.2%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 210.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#4c80b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00016d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4c80b6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4c80b6 has RGB values of R:76, G:128,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5013686.

Hex triplet 4c80b6 #4c80b6
RGB Decimal 76, 128, 182 rgb(76,128,182)
RGB Percent 29.8, 50.2, 71.4 rgb(29.8%,50.2%,71.4%)
CMYK 58, 30, 0, 29
HSL 210.6°, 42.1, 50.6 hsl(210.6,42.1%,50.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 210.6°, 58.2, 71.4
Web Safe 3399cc #3399cc
CIE-LAB 52.232, -1.027, -33.694
XYZ 19.141, 20.351, 47.173
xyY 0.221, 0.235, 20.351
CIE-LCH 52.232, 33.71, 268.255
CIE-LUV 52.232, -22.755, -51.08
Hunter-Lab 45.112, -3.208, -30.42
Binary 01001100, 10000000, 10110110

Shades and Tints of #4c80b6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c80b6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8186 is the less saturated color, while #087ffa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4c80b6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#777777 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6e7984 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7181b6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6982bb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#438d97 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#6381b6 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#5e81b9 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#4688a2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
